2). The toy box for pets turns backwards on it's on and then the dog will whine as it can't get a ball to play with.
3). Sims are walking the farthest distance again to do simple tasks. For example, my Sim is now going upstairs to the bathroom to prepare dinner on the counter and then walking downstairs to the stove to cook it when there is plenty of counter space downstairs in the kitchen (this bug is really getting annoying).
4). Playing the vet, sometimes I notice that the patient will get on the exam table, and then the exam table will lower back down before my Sim examines the patient, and my Sim will call the patient back, patient gets back on the exam table and then it'll lower again. This could go on for hours
5). When you adopt a pet into a household that already has a dog...you may lose the 'Training' interaction from the menu. It just disappears. As a test, I moved out all pets and got a new dog and the menu was back, but training wouldn't work on the old dog I had.
6). The 'Adoption' via phone/computer does not work on 'Save' files pre-cats/dogs patch. The service person comes....you click on the pet to adopt, you hear the music, but the pet is never added to the home. The adoption via phone/computer only works if you start a new game
7). Dogs are always afraid. I don't mind this for a dog that is jumpy. But I have an aggressive dog and seeing him being so scared constantly doesn't fit his traits/personality to me. A temporary fix for cancelling interactions in the queue thing is don't put the speed to 2 or 3, always keep it at 1 when you are waiting for them to start the interaction. Once they start it its fine and you can speed it up. If its at speed 2 and especially 3 and they have to walk quite a ways for the interaction they will almost always cancel it.
